1967 Alfa Romeo Spider vs. 2003 Kia Sephia II
To start off, 2003 Kia Sephia II is newer by 36 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1967 Alfa Romeo Spider.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1967 Alfa Romeo Spider would be higher. At 2,582 cc (6 cylinders), 1967 Alfa Romeo Spider is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1967 Alfa Romeo Spider (163 HP @ 5900 RPM) has 84 more horse power than 2003 Kia Sephia II. (79 HP @ 5500 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1967 Alfa Romeo Spider should accelerate faster than 2003 Kia Sephia II.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1967 Alfa Romeo Spider weights approximately 275 kg more than 2003 Kia Sephia II.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Let's talk about torque, 1967 Alfa Romeo Spider (220 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 98 more torque (in Nm) than 2003 Kia Sephia II. (122 Nm @ 2500 RPM). This means 1967 Alfa Romeo Spider will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2003 Kia Sephia II.
